Great first time experience for myself and my family. Visited my younger siblings who go to university upstate for my birthday and found Patina 250!

We were only able to make lunch but would’ve loved to try their dinner menu. We walked through the Westin entrance and rounded the corner to the entrance of Patina. We were immediately greeted and sat at a nice round table by the window. It offered a nice view of the beautiful kitchen as well.

They knew we were celebrating a birthday and had a custom made card at the table.

Our server was very sweet and polite. She was attentive and friendly. The food was absolutely delicious as well.

We ordered the Brussels sprouts and Patina house rolls for appetizers. The bread was absolutely fresh and delicious. It came with a side of their maple butter. For lunch, we ordered the sea bass, lobster roll, steak frites, poke bowl, and the squid ink torchietti. For desserts I ordered the tiramisu. My family ordered the daily selection of ice cream and the matcha cheesecake.

Our server even took care of my dessert as a birthday gift.

Gratuity was already included as our party was a size of six. I still tipped a bit extra as she was so kind. When I were to visit my siblings again, I’ll be sure to get a room in the Westin next time so I can visit the restaurant too!

The food was served promptly and it was ALL delicious. We had appetizers, salads and entrees. A member of our party had celiac and must be gluten-free. They have so many available options, that are always on the menu, not just substitutions. A jumbo lump crab cake that is gluten free?! Amazing!
